CheckUP is an independent not-for-profit organisation dedicated to creating healthier communities and reducing health inequities. We pursue this by working collaboratively at the strategic, regional, and local level to lead improvements in health. We design and facilitate the delivery of efficient and effective healthcare solutions. As experts in made-to-order health programs, we connect the right people and organisations to deliver a range of innovative healthcare services for hard-to-reach individuals and communities. We have an established footprint in almost 200 communities across Queensland and the Northern Territory, and our initiatives support people living in rural and remote geographical areas, as well as those with poor access due to social or economic barriers. Learn the ins and outs of the newest Child Safety Legislation

Queensland's latest child safeguarding law, the Child Safe Organisations Act, has begun to roll out and will significantly affect all organisations in QLD that interact with children.

CheckUP’s free one-hour webinar featuring Jane Reid, Principal Advisor from the Family and Child Commission, is a valuable opportunity to get a clear, practical walkthrough of the reforms and the steps needed to take to ensure your service is compliant by 2026.

What to expect from the session
- Explanation of what the 10 new Child Safe Standards mean for your team
- How your organisation can prepare to implement the Child Safe Standards
- How the Reportable Conduct Scheme will work in practice

A happy farewell and Congratulations to Aunty Gail Wason!

CheckUP would like to extend our heartfelt congratulations and best wishes to Aunty Gail Wason, for recently moving on from CEO of NATSIHA (the Northern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Health Alliance) to take on a new chapter as Practice Manager in Mareeba.

A respected leader whose contributions have been recognised through multiple industry awards, Aunty Gail’s work at NATSIHA has significantly improved the health and wellbeing of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ander communities. Aunty Gail’s commitment to enhancing health outcomes has led to better opportunities for these communities and created educational pathways that supports young Indigenous students to pursue rewarding careers in health.

Those who have worked alongside Aunty Gail knows her for her generosity, unwavering dedication to the community by reminding everyone of the importance of connection, respect, and self-determination.

When Chithrani Palipana's son Dinesh was paralysed in 2010, she made a promise to stand by him.

Today, he's Dr Dinesh Palipana OAM, Queensland's first quadriplegic medical intern and 2021 Australian of the Year.

Chithrani turned her traumatic life experience into purpose. Completing a Master of Rehabilitation Counselling, she now empowers people with disability to rebuild confidence and pursue meaningful lives.

Living with double deficit dyslexia and short-term memory loss, Joshua Bamford manages 650+ staff across seven McDonald's restaurants in Toowoomba.

He's turned his own experience into action that's changing lives across regional Queensland.

What he's achieved:
✅ 65+ people with disability placed in meaningful jobs
✅ Founded Queensland's first Disability Employment Taskforce under WorkForce Australia
✅ Created employment pathways for refugees, First Nations youth, and overlooked jobseekers

His approach? Recruit genuine people for genuine jobs. Judge on merit. Make adjustments. Treat inclusion as the norm, not the exception.

🛣 On the road with Ed Mosby: Supporting rural mental health in Queensland

🌏 As World Mental Health Awareness 2025 wraps up on 31 October, we invite you to read about CheckUP health provider and psychologist Ed Mosby.

🔸 For Ed, rural Queensland isn’t just a destination; it’s a community he holds close. As CEO and senior psychologist at Wakai Waian Healing, Ed leads regular peer support sessions and provides one-on-one check-ins, offering vital mental health support to healthcare professionals. His work helps reduce stress and prevent burnout, especially in remote areas where formal mental health services are limited.
